What Makes a Neighbourhood "Prestigious" in Kuwait
In Kuwait, prestige is not measured by the buildings alone. The first criterion is plot type: districts planned as private housing on 750 to 1,000 square metre plots, with no investment buildings allowed, keep their value and their quiet for decades. The second is scarcity: in Abdullah Al-Salem or Shamiya, only a few dozen sale listings may appear in an entire year. The third is location relative to the city centre, international schools and the waterfront.

The Ranking at a Glance
| Rank | District | Governorate | Dominant housing | Villa prices (KD)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Abdullah Al-Salem | Capital | Private villas on large plots | From 500,000, above one million |
| 2 | Shamiya | Capital | Established family villas on wide plots | From about 600,000 (indicative) |
| 3 | Shaab | Capital | Villas near the corniche | From about 550,000 (indicative) |
| 4 | Mishref | Hawally | Modern villas and upscale apartments | From about 450,000 (indicative); apartment rent 220-350 monthly |
| 5 | Surra | Hawally | Villas and apartments in a quiet district | 300,000-480,000; apartment rent 300-500 |
| 6 | Bayan | Hawally | Villas and apartments near Bayan Palace | 280,000-450,000; apartment rent 280-400 |
| 7 | Hateen | Hawally | Modern family villas | 350,000-700,000 |
| 8 | Yarmouk | Capital | Family villas | From about 400,000 (indicative) |
| 9 | Qortuba | Capital | Family villas | 270,000-420,000 |
| 10 | Hessah Al-Mubarak | Capital | Upscale apartments in new developments | Ownership apartments; no villas |
1. Abdullah Al-Salem — The Undisputed Top
The oldest of the Capital's elite districts, home to long-established Kuwaiti families who rarely sell. Plots are wide, inner streets are quiet, and Kuwait City is minutes away. Supply is close to zero, which is why villas start from 500,000 KD and pass one million for large plots on main roads. 2. Shamiya — The Quieter Neighbour
Adjacent to Abdullah Al-Salem and built on the same plan: large plots and two-storey villas for extended families. Its edge is proximity to the old Kuwait University campus and the First Ring Road; its constraint is that most houses pass by inheritance, not sale. The few listings that do appear start from about 600,000 KD.
3. Shaab — Between the City and the Sea
A villa district close to Shaab corniche and Shaab Park, for anyone who wants a large Capital plot with the sea a few minutes away. Villas start from about 550,000 KD. 4. Mishref — Modern Prestige in Hawally
The newest plan on the list, mixing contemporary villas with upscale apartments near Kuwait University, the Fairgrounds and The Avenues. Apartment rents run 220 to 350 KD a month according to the Mishref guide, and villas start from about 450,000 KD. It suits young families who want an upscale district with modern services rather than older houses.
5. Surra — Family Quiet at a Sensible Price
One of Hawally's most prestigious areas, with quiet inner streets, international schools and quick access to King Fahd Road. Villas run 300,000 to 480,000 KD, and villa apartments 300 to 500 KD a month per the Surra guide. It is where many buyers begin the search for an upscale district under half a million.
6. Bayan — Beside the Palace
Named after Bayan Palace and bordered by Mishref, Salwa and Mubarak Al-Abdullah. Family villas run 280,000 to 450,000 KD and apartments 280 to 400 KD a month per the Bayan guide. Its main advantage is Surra-level pricing with closer access to the Salwa coastline.
7. Hateen — Hawally's Priciest After Mishref
An entirely modern villa district, built over the last two decades with large footprints and contemporary designs, which explains the wide price band: 350,000 to 700,000 KD per the Hateen guide. Parks and international schools on its edges make it one of the most sought-after family districts in Hawally.
8. Yarmouk — The Capital Without the Noise
A family villa district in the Capital governorate near the Fourth Ring Road, quieter than Qortuba and closer to Kuwait City than most of Hawally. Supply is limited and villas start from about 400,000 KD. It suits anyone working in the city who wants a private-housing plot without paying the Abdullah Al-Salem premium.
9. Qortuba — The Cheapest Door into the Capital's Prime Districts
The largest district on the list by villa count, which means wider supply and calmer prices: 270,000 to 420,000 KD per the Qortuba guide. International schools, inner parks and the Fifth Ring Road make it the practical choice for a Capital address on a Hawally budget.
10. Hessah Al-Mubarak — The Only Prestigious District Built on Apartments
The exception on the list: an entirely new district of apartments rather than villas, with sea views and a restaurant and café frontage that made it the first address for upscale apartment living in the Capital. Worth Mentioning Beyond the Ten
- Messila and Abu Al-Hasaniya: the upscale southern coast in Mubarak Al-Kabeer, with large sea-view villas for anyone who accepts a longer drive to the city.
- Jabriya and Salwa: upscale in services and schools, but investment buildings mix the residential fabric, so they fall outside a "private villas" ranking. See the Jabriya guide and the Salwa guide.
- Khaldiya, Kaifan and Rawda: established Capital districts priced close to Yarmouk, a fallback when nothing is listed in the ten above.
How to Choose Between the Ten
Above 600,000 KD the real comparison is Abdullah Al-Salem, Shamiya and Shaab, and the difference is distance to the sea, not quality. Between 400,000 and 600,000 KD, Mishref, Hateen and Yarmouk enter, and building age decides: Hateen and Mishref are modern houses, Yarmouk is closer to the city. Under 400,000 KD, Surra, Bayan and Qortuba compete, all within roughly the same international-school catchment. For an upscale apartment rather than a villa, Hessah Al-Mubarak first, then Shaab Al-Bahri.
